Hardik Pandya Gets Out In A Bizzare Fashion; Fans Can’t Stop Trolling

Hardik Pandya

It was a tailor-made situation for Hardik Pandya as the platform was set by Rohit Sharma and Suryakumar Yadav up top for the middle order to go hard against the Kolkata Knight Riders bowling which looked rusty in their opening fixture of this Indian Premier League. It was Andre Russell who came up to bowl and the West Indies all-rounder dropped in a couple of yorkers. So going back in striker Hardik was deep into his crease anticipating Russell to bowler another yorker.

The Funny Dismissal That Trended On Twitter

To everyone’s surprise, the Mumbai Indians allrounder struck his own wicket with his willow and got out by hit wicket. Andre Russell could not believe what happened as Dinesh Karthik went up appealing and finally realizing that the explosive batsman has committed a very unforced error.

Mumbai Indians lost the early wicket of Quinton de Kock but from there Rohit Sharma and Suryakumar Yadav started counter-attacking the KKR bowlers and smashed them to all parts of the ground. Rohit Sharma perished after scoring 80 while Yadav scored 47.

Pandya has looked rusty mostly so after the long break from cricket and also he coming back from a serious back injury. Hardik could only manage 18 runs off 13 deliveries after he got out in the 19th over to Russell. He went back to the dugout with a sheepish smile on his face realising his mistake.

Hardik Pandya Needs To Do Better; As The Fans Had A Laugh

Hardik was sidelined because of his back injury. However, he had his surgery in October and was out of action as he was recuperating. He gradually got better and was named in  India’s ODI squad for the home series against South Africa in March. Despite that, the series was postponed due to the Coronavirus pandemic.

The reigning IPL champions lost their first game against Chennai Super Kings and there Jasprit Bumrah had a bad day at the office but we did not see captain Rohit Sharma turning the ball towards Hardik Pandya even for one over. So it seems that the Indian allrounder is not 100% ready to bend his back and today he looked rusty with the bat too.

Mumbai Indians who enjoy a great record against the Knight Riders have posted a mammoth total of 195 as Shivam Mavi managed to pull back a few runs at the end. The total which once looked like crossing 200 easily has been pulled back a little but it will be interesting to see how the KKR batters fare on this Abu Dhabi wicket.
